NICE, FRANCE. This was our "relaxation" stop, a place were we could slow down, catch up on rest from the busy wedding and Barcelona stop. We had a hotel right on the coast of the Mediterranean Sea. It was beautiful...The area was so laid back, and had a calm feeling to it.
One nice thing we noticed was there was actually a lot to see there. From Churches that were hidden among trees, or buildings, to the many statues throughout the city.
One unique thing that we found was the awesome market. It was packed with people buying fresh seafood and fruit, as well as paintings and just about anything else you could possibly want.
